CLI-Anything: Haz que cualquier software esté listo para agentes de IA
CLI-Anything: Hacer que TODO software sea nativo de agentes en un solo comando
El software de hoy sirve a los humanos a través de GUIs. Los agentes de mañana necesitan interfaces CLI estructuradas. Entra CLI-Anything—un plugin revolucionario de Claude Code que transforma automáticamente cualquier base de código de software en CLIs listos para producción y controlables por agentes.
🎯 El vacío agente-software resuelto
Los agentes de IA destacan en razonamiento pero luchan con software profesional. CLI-Anything cierra esta brecha mediante:
- Integración directa con el backend: Llama a Blender, GIMP, LibreOffice reales—no implementaciones de juguete
- Cero fragilidad de GUI: Sin capturas de pantalla, sin RPA, pura confiabilidad de línea de comandos
- Salida JSON estructurada: Consumo fluido por agentes + formatos legibles por humanos
- Automatización en un comando: Pipeline de 7 fases desde análisis hasta paquete listo para PyPI
🚀 Inicio rápido en 5 minutos
/plugin marketplace add HKUDS/CLI-Anything
/plugin install cli-anything
/cli-anything ./gimp
cd gimp/agent-harness && pip install -e .
cli-anything-gimp --help
Eso es todo. Ahora tienes un CLI completamente probado para GIMP con 107 pruebas aprobadas.
✅ Probado en batalla en 9 aplicaciones
| Software | Dominio | Pruebas aprobadas | Comando CLI |
|---|---|---|---|
| GIMP | Edición de imágenes | 107 ✅ | cli-anything-gimp |
| Blender | Modelado 3D | 208 ✅ | cli-anything-blender |
| Inkscape | Gráficos vectoriales | 202 ✅ | cli-anything-inkscape |
| Audacity | Producción de audio | 161 ✅ | cli-anything-audacity |
| LibreOffice | Suite de oficina | 158 ✅ | cli-anything-libreoffice |
| OBS Studio | Transmisión en vivo | 153 ✅ | cli-anything-obs-studio |
| Kdenlive | Edición de video | 155 ✅ | cli-anything-kdenlive |
| Shotcut | Edición de video | 154 ✅ | cli-anything-shotcut |
| Draw.io | Diagramación | 138 ✅ | cli-anything-drawio |
Total: 1.436 pruebas, 100% de aprobación.
🎮 Flujos de trabajo reales de agentes
# Crear entregables profesionales
cli-anything-libreoffice document new -o report.json --type writer
cli-anything-libreoffice --project report.json writer add-heading -t "Informe Q1" --level 1
cli-anything-libreoffice --project report.json export render output.pdf -p pdf
# Visualización de productos 3D
cli-anything-blender scene new --name ProductShot
cli-anything-blender[ProductShot] object add-mesh --type cube --location 0 0 1
cli-anything-blender[ProductShot] render execute --output render.png --engine CYCLES
🔧 ¿Por qué CLI > GUI para agentes?
- Estructurado y compuesto: Comandos de texto se encadenan perfectamente con razonamiento LLM
- Universal: Funciona en Windows/Mac/Linux sin dependencias
- Auto-documentado: Banderas
--helpproporcionan descubrimiento automático de API - Determinístico: Salida JSON consistente elimina complejidad de análisis
- Comprobado: Claude Code ejecuta miles de flujos de trabajo CLI diariamente
🌐 Casos de uso en diversas industrias
- 🎨 Creativo: GIMP, Blender, Inkscape, OBS Studio
- 📊 Datos: JupyterLab, Metabase, DBeaver
- 💻 DevOps: Jenkins, Gitea, ArgoCD
- 🏢 Empresarial: LibreOffice, NextCloud, Odoo
- 📐 Diagramación: Draw.io, Mermaid, PlantUML
📦 Arquitectura lista para producción
- Integración auténtica: Backends de software real (bpy, GEGL, ODF, MLT)
- Interacción dual: REPL con estado + scripting de subcomandos
- Instalación sin configuración:
pip install -e .→ listo para PATH - Pruebas multicapa: 1.011 unitarias + 425 E2E
- Diseño agente-primero: Bandera
--jsonen cada comando
🚀 Comienza hoy
git clone https://github.com/HKUDS/CLI-Anything.git
/plugin marketplace add HKUDS/CLI-Anything
/plugin install cli-anything
/cli-anything <your-software-path>
Transforma cualquier base de código en herramientas nativas de agentes. Sin APIs necesarias. Sin hackeo de GUI. Solo poder CLI estructurado.
⭐ Dale estrella a CLI-Anything en GitHub y únete al futuro nativo de agentes!